Local tips
- Visit early in the morning for cooler temperatures and fewer crowds.
- Wear comfortable walking shoes to enjoy the extensive paths throughout the gardens.
- Don't forget your camera; the landscapes are breathtaking and perfect for photographs.
- Check the schedule for guided tours to enhance your understanding of the plant species.
- Bring a hat and sunscreen, as some areas are exposed to the sun.
